What the whole agricultural and homestead exemptions really mean? I tried the webpage for findlaw, I still don't really get it yet. How do you get this and anything. I'm confused!

Agricultural exemption....if you own land that you farm or raise stock

Homestead.....the home that you reside in as your own...as opposed to rental or investment property in addition to your homestead.

Quote:
Originally Posted by sunshineshallow View Post
oh and are these things good? Having the homestead and/or the agricultural exemptions?

Yes. You should definitely have the homestead exemption if you own your home.
If you qualify for the Ag exemption it helps out tremendously. I am in a different county so I don't know if it applies to Bexar but we have to show 5 years of ranching/farming before the ag exemption takes place.

It is definitely worth looking into.
